In line of the 13th five year plan period (2016-2020), China is planning to invest around 2.8 trillion yuan for railway construction and building no less than 23,000 kilometers of new rail lines. The Chinese government is planning to help 12 million people out of poverty by boosting local tourism in the next five years. Premier Li Keqiang announced the plans during the opening ceremony during the first World Conference on Tourism for Development.
